What does a Customer Service Officer do?

A Customer Service Officer is responsible for managing customer interactions, addressing inquiries, and ensuring a positive customer experience. This role involves effective communication, problem-solving, and adherence to company service standards.

Tasks required include:

  • Interact with customers through various channels, including phone calls, emails, and chat..
  • Provide accurate and timely information to customers, addressing inquiries and offering assistance..
  • Resolve customer concerns, complaints, or issues in a prompt and efficient manner..
  • Document customer interactions and resolutions in the customer relationship management (CRM) system..
  • Stay informed about company products or services to provide relevant information to customers..
  • Collaborate with other departments to ensure timely resolution of customer issues..
  • Gather and relay customer feedback to contribute to continuous improvement efforts..
  • Identify opportunities for upselling or cross-selling additional products or services..
  • Adhere to company policies, procedures, and service standards..
  • Collaborate with team members to share knowledge and best practices..
What are the entry requirements for a Customer Service Officer?

There are no formal academic entry requirements, although many employers expect candidates to possess GCSEs/S grades. Training is typically provided on-the-job, supplemented by specialist short courses.
